After serving at St. Marks for 5 1/2 years, our previous Rector, The Rev. Tom Sramek, Jr. accepted a call to another parish. His last day was Sunday, May 1, 2022. For 6 1/2 months following Rev. Tom's departure, St. Mark’s had the privilege of Rev. Dr. Anthony (Tony) Hutchinson, former rector of Trinity Ashland, stepping in as our supply priest until we were able to hire our interim rector, Rev. Dr. Jane Maynard, who began her tenure with us on November 20, 2022. We have been blessed with all of these amazing priests, and eagerly look forward to new leadership to lead us into a new chapter at St. Marks.

At St. Mark's, our mission is to be people who are "sharing Christ's love by feeding people in body, mind, and spirit." We feed people in body through our food pantry, providing meals to the Kelly Shelter, and our various potlucks and other social events. We feed people's minds through our book and Bible studies, our adult forums, and the sermons we are invited to reflect upon on Sundays. Spiritually, we feed people through those same sermons and our worship and prayer ministries.
Author and Episcopal Deacon Sarah Miles once wrote “the point of church isn't to get people to come to church....[but] to feed them, so they can go out and...be Jesus." (Take this Bread, A Radical Conversion). It is our intention that those who come to us--either through the church door or the Community Hall door--are strengthened to be Jesus in the world.
